    Artist's Note:

    My daughter is the inspiration behind this image and also the model for it. A lesson at church had inspired her sufficiently to say how timely a painting of a wise virgin would be, eagerly awaiting the second coming of our Savior. I wanted to create the expression of the young women as she gazes steadfastly and confidently in the direction she knows the bridegroom will come, her lamp trimmed and burning brightly with oil she has accumulated a drop at a time, with enough to fill a vessel in case it is needed. The time is far spent, may we all catch the vision and not delay in our efforts to prepare for the return of the Son of God.

    The Artist:

    Simon Dewey started his journey at seventeen when he decided to leave home and attend London Art College. He gained popularity in 1997 when he released the painting "He Lives," that the LDS audience loved. His art often is from the New Testament, mainly focusing on the life of Jesus Christ. He is best known as a portrait painter of mainly religious art.
